Bujingda Zheng is at the forefront of autonomous materials discovery and advanced manufacturing, pioneering the integration of robotics, machine learning, and materials science. His most impactful work, "Accelerate Synthesis of Metal–Organic Frameworks by a Robotic Platform and Bayesian Optimization" (76 citations), revolutionizes how complex chemical spaces are navigated, enabling rapid, data-driven synthesis of MOFs with desired structures—a critical step toward functional materials for energy and catalysis. Zheng also advanced 3D electronics with "Direct Freeform Laser Fabrication of 3D Conformable Electronics" (59 citations), developing a sophisticated method to create conformable devices on freeform surfaces, overcoming traditional planar limitations and opening new avenues for wearable and bio-integrated electronics. Demonstrating his versatility, he engineered an autonomous robot for shell and tube heat exchanger inspection (9 citations), automating eddy current testing to enhance power plant efficiency and safety. These contributions showcase Zheng’s unique ability to blend automation, AI, and engineering to solve real-world challenges, marking him as a rising leader in autonomous research systems and functional materials innovation.
